What is The Sims 4’s “Honeymoon of Horror”?
InThe Sims 4: Get Togetherexpansion pack, a new world called Windenburg featuring Gothic architecture was introduced. One of these Gothic structures is the historic Von Haunt Estate located in the uppermost area of Windenburg. It’s been preserved as a museum and tourist attraction where Sims can learn about the history of the estate and explore its massive garden maze. However, the Von Haunt Estate is also known for having paranormal occurrences.
When players visit the Von Haunt Estate, they can interact with the plaques around the mansion to read about its history. It was owned by Lord Bernard Escargot Shallot IV and Lady Mimsy Alcorn Shallot, who died together in a fire that partially burned the mansion in 1898. A plaque in the Dining Room claimed that the blaze was caused by Lord Shallot, a struggling artist who often burned his paintings. Because of these incidents, some Sims claim to have seen ghosts in the area, which Von Haunt Estate Management repeatedly denied. In the Bedroom, the plaque said that it’s no longer available for overnight stays due to the “Honeymoon of Horror” incident. It didn’t specify what happened, but an insurance company warned Management that no person should spend the night in the mansion.
Sims 4fans have several theories about what happened during the Honeymoon of Horror. It’s possible that Lord and Lady Shallot’s deaths happened while spending their honeymoon in the Von Haunt Estate. Another spooky theory could be that a newly-wed couple saw the Shallots' ghosts, or worse, were murdered when they stayed over at the mansion. This could explain why some visiting Sims experience paranormal incidents, especially at night.
As of now,The Sims 4didn’t provide a concrete explanationon what happened during the Honeymoon of Horror. Many players can only guess based on the plaques around the mansion. Notably, there’s a real-world thriller film titledHoneymoon of Horrorthat came out in 1964. Directed by Irwin Meyer, it revolves around famous sculptor Emile Duvre and his new wife Lilli as they move into Emile’s luxurious home. Lilli starts fearing for her safety when she gets phone calls from people threatening her life, and also experiences a series of near-death accidents. She later finds out that her husband’s friends are plotting to murder her. In addition, the mystery of the film also revolves around Emile’s collection of golden statues.
Apart from the similar name, the plot seems similar toThe Sims 4’s mystery. Both involves a strange artist living in a lavish home, and their wives who witnessed their artistry and possibly fell victim to their deadly actions. It’s possible that Maxistook inspiration from Meyer’s flick when it created the Von Haunt Estate in Windenburg. It’s no secret that the studio had taken notes from other real-world elements and added them inThe Sims, so this theory could hold up.
